Q. How should you feed water to a boiler?
A. Continuously during the whole time that steam is being used.
Q. Will a steam pump feed continuously?
A. Yes, by running the pump faster or slower according to the amount of water required.
Q. Why is a continuous feed preferable?
A. Because it maintains the water in the boiler at a uniform level and gives the most perfect action.
